Free Photo Restoration & Date Old Photographs / Re: Can anyone date this motorbike?
« on: Sunday 25 September 16 03:57 BST (UK)  »
If you can find someone with the glass book of registration plates, they should be able to give a rough date of when that reg plate was issued.

It's either a BSA or a norton and probably late 1920s

CH was a derby registration plate if that helps
